Studies on the Regioselective Reductive Ringcleavage Reactions of 3,5-O-Arylidene- d-xylofuranosides

&
Pages 2349-2363 | Received 24 Oct 2002, Published online: 17 Aug 2006
 

Abstract

Reductive ring cleavage of 3,5-O-arylidene-d-xylofuranosides using LiA1H4–A1C13 and NaBH3CN–BF3 proceeded regioselectively to provide secondary alcohol as the major product. The effect of the substitutents on the selectivity is examined.
